Indira Gandhi Indoor Stadium: Lakshya Sen admitted he was disappointed after his shock second-round exit from the BWF World Championships in New Delhi, saying he was forced to play a catch-up game for much of his contest against USA’s Garret Tan.
The 14th-seeded Indian, who won a bronze medal at the 2021 World Championships, clinched the first game but could not hold on to his lead, as the 18-year-old American, who is 92nd in the world rankings, managed to come back and win 19-21, 21-19, 21-17 after 73 minutes at the Indira Gandhi Indoor Stadium on Wednesday.
“It was a good match. I gave a lot of credit to my opponent. He played a very solid game,” Lakshya said after the defeat.
